]> git.ipfire.org Git - thirdparty/pdns.git/commitdiff
drop focal builds and start building rec-5.2.x instead of rec-4.9.x 15277/head
authorOtto Moerbeek <otto.moerbeek@open-xchange.com>
Tue, 11 Mar 2025 08:59:23 +0000 (09:59 +0100)
committerOtto Moerbeek <otto.moerbeek@open-xchange.com>
Tue, 11 Mar 2025 09:20:15 +0000 (10:20 +0100)
.github/workflows/build-and-test-all-releases-dispatch.yml
.github/workflows/builder-dispatch.yml
.github/workflows/builder-releases-dispatch.yml
builder-support/dockerfiles/Dockerfile.target.ubuntu-focal [deleted file]

index 32fad390f29e316fe09bde502747e835d8aa8986..ea2ef3a9d3a9a2521f491760a8e08e9d81df12b7 100644 (file)
@@ -36,6 +36,12 @@ jobs:
     with:
       branch-name: rel/auth-4.7.x
 
+  call-build-and-test-all-rec-52:
+    if: ${{ vars.SCHEDULED_JOBS_BUILD_AND_TEST_ALL }}
+    uses: PowerDNS/pdns/.github/workflows/build-and-test-all.yml@rel/rec-5.2.x
+    with:
+      branch-name: rel/rec-5.2.x
+
   call-build-and-test-all-rec-51:
     if: ${{ vars.SCHEDULED_JOBS_BUILD_AND_TEST_ALL }}
     uses: PowerDNS/pdns/.github/workflows/build-and-test-all.yml@rel/rec-5.1.x
@@ -48,12 +54,6 @@ jobs:
     with:
       branch-name: rel/rec-5.0.x
 
-  call-build-and-test-all-rec-49:
-    if: ${{ vars.SCHEDULED_JOBS_BUILD_AND_TEST_ALL }}
-    uses: PowerDNS/pdns/.github/workflows/build-and-test-all.yml@rel/rec-4.9.x
-    with:
-      branch-name: rel/rec-4.9.x
-
   call-build-and-test-all-dnsdist-19:
     if: ${{ vars.SCHEDULED_JOBS_BUILD_AND_TEST_ALL }}
     uses: PowerDNS/pdns/.github/workflows/build-and-test-all.yml@rel/dnsdist-1.9.x
index fe57f661a8e53016357f5a6f7dc4f2e68f3cc4f1..83a9f82412efc898b4df95d4b1d80b25a98b17b5 100644 (file)
@@ -20,7 +20,6 @@ on:
           el-9
           debian-bullseye
           debian-bookworm
-          ubuntu-focal
           ubuntu-jammy
           ubuntu-noble
       ref:
index e18e69db5e3bb1b5dffab4f3ba0635f961d9e46a..54b057e0e4a8e82fd0b34302c08b901294bb9ec7 100644 (file)
@@ -29,6 +29,12 @@ jobs:
     with:
       branch-name: rel/auth-4.7.x
 
+  call-builder-rec-52:
+    if: ${{ vars.SCHEDULED_JOBS_BUILDER }}
+    uses: PowerDNS/pdns/.github/workflows/builder.yml@rel/rec-5.2.x
+    with:
+      branch-name: rel/rec-5.2.x
+
   call-builder-rec-51:
     if: ${{ vars.SCHEDULED_JOBS_BUILDER }}
     uses: PowerDNS/pdns/.github/workflows/builder.yml@rel/rec-5.1.x
@@ -41,12 +47,6 @@ jobs:
     with:
       branch-name: rel/rec-5.0.x
 
-  call-builder-rec-49:
-    if: ${{ vars.SCHEDULED_JOBS_BUILDER }}
-    uses: PowerDNS/pdns/.github/workflows/builder.yml@rel/rec-4.9.x
-    with:
-      branch-name: rel/rec-4.9.x
-
   call-builder-dnsdist-19:
     if: ${{ vars.SCHEDULED_JOBS_BUILDER }}
     uses: PowerDNS/pdns/.github/workflows/builder.yml@rel/dnsdist-1.9.x
diff --git a/builder-support/dockerfiles/Dockerfile.target.ubuntu-focal b/builder-support/dockerfiles/Dockerfile.target.ubuntu-focal
deleted file mode 100644 (file)
index 110eebd..0000000
+++ /dev/null
@@ -1,28 +0,0 @@
-# First do the source builds
-@INCLUDE Dockerfile.target.sdist
-
-FROM ubuntu:focal as dist-base
-
-ARG BUILDER_CACHE_BUSTER=
-ARG APT_URL
-RUN apt-get update && apt-get -y dist-upgrade
-
-@INCLUDE Dockerfile.debbuild-prepare
-
-@IF [ -n "$M_authoritative$M_all" ]
-ADD builder-support/debian/authoritative/debian-buster/ pdns-${BUILDER_VERSION}/debian/
-@ENDIF
-
-@IF [ -n "$M_recursor$M_all" ]
-ADD builder-support/debian/recursor/debian-buster/ pdns-recursor-${BUILDER_VERSION}/debian/
-@ENDIF
-
-@IF [ -n "$M_dnsdist$M_all" ]
-ADD builder-support/debian/dnsdist/debian-bullseye/ dnsdist-${BUILDER_VERSION}/debian/
-@ENDIF
-
-@INCLUDE Dockerfile.debbuild
-
-# Do a test install and verify
-# Can be skipped with skiptests=1 in the environment
-# @EXEC [ "$skiptests" = "" ] && include Dockerfile.debtest